// Fixture for Puzzlewick's grid validator tests.
// Heads up for review: these grids are intentionally malformed
// (overlapping clues, broken symmetry) to exercise the sanitizer.
// Nothing here touches prod data — the fixture hits the mock
// generator service only. The mock still enforces auth, though,
// so requests go out with the token below.

session JWT of yahif-bawig = eyJhbGciOiJIUzI1NiIsInR5cCI6IkpXVCJ9.eyJzdWIiOiIaWAxmMIn0.GYffpIaj

Quarterly Planning Note — Lease Renegotiation

Quick update for the board: we've opened talks with the landlord at the Fennwick Park office, and early signals are good. We're pushing for a 15% rent reduction plus a break clause in year three. If they don't budge, the Ashgrove site remains a solid fallback. The reason we want that flexibility is noted confidentially below.

board note of fahif-yahog: Gross margin on Wenath came in at 10 percent against a plan of 5 percent. Only 3 of the 100 pilot accounts renewed Wenath, so a churn review is set for July 15.

/*
 * Client setup for the Gridmark barcode scanner bridge.
 * This block initializes the connection to the Tagfeed internal API,
 * which receives decoded scan payloads from warehouse handhelds.
 * Please keep the timeout at 5s — Tagfeed's queue can lag during
 * receiving hours, and shorter values cause duplicate submissions.
 * The client authenticates with a static service key, defined on
 * the next line:
 */

app token of tadug-yahag = vxb3-949

# ScanBridge Limits

ScanBridge caps barcode lookups per device to protect the Quillhaven catalog service. Burst scanning beyond the cap queues locally; the queue drains at a fixed rate. Offline mode stores up to the buffer limit, then drops oldest first. Tell merchants to batch, not hammer. Current limits are listed below.

tuning table, yajog-yahof:
BUDGETS = {
    "lamvan": 303,
    "wenox": 460,
    "fenvan": 525,
}